Core Viewpoint - The article highlights the impact of tariff fears and geopolitical tensions on global markets, leading to a decline in European stocks and a slight drop in Hong Kong indices [1] Group 1: Market Performance - US markets were closed overnight, while European stocks experienced significant declines [1] - Hong Kong's three major indices opened slightly lower, with the Hang Seng Index down 0.07%, the National Index down 0.16%, and the Hang Seng Tech Index down 0.22% [1] Group 2: Company Performance - Major technology stocks showed weakness, with Baidu falling over 2%, and Tencent and Xiaomi both declining more than 1.2% [1] - AI application concept stocks saw renewed activity, with Zhihui rising 3.6% [1] - New consumption concept stocks collectively increased, with Pop Mart rising over 5%, and Hu Shang Ayi and China Duty Free both up 2% and 2.8% respectively [1] - Real estate stocks mostly declined, with Country Garden down 4.6% and heavy machinery stock China National Heavy Duty Truck Group falling nearly 5% [1]
